Publication number: 20240120812Abstract: An integrated motor and drive assembly is disclosed and includes a housing, a motor and a drive. The housing includes a motor-accommodation portion and a drive-accommodation portion. The drive includes a power board and a control board. The power board is made of a high thermal conductivity substrate and includes a power element and an encoder disposed on the first side, the first side faces the motor, the power board and the motor are stacked along a first direction, and the second side contacts the housing to from a heat-dissipating route. The control board is disposed adjacent to the power board. The control board and the power board are arranged along a second direction perpendicular to the first direction, and the first direction is parallel to an axial direction of the motor. A part of the power board and a part of the control board are directly contacted to form an electrical connection.Type: ApplicationFiled: July 17, 2023Publication date: April 11, 2024Inventors: Chi-Hsiang Kuo, Yi-Yu Lee, Zuo-Ying Wei, Yuan-Kai Liao, Wen-Cheng Hsieh

Publication number: 20230283514Abstract: An example system includes network devices at a site; and a network management system (NMS) that is configured to: identify a first network device of the plurality of network devices with which a network connection has been lost; identify, based on a network topology graph generated from the network data, one or more neighbor network devices of the plurality of network devices that are connected to the first network device; perform root cause analysis of the lost connection with the first network device based on the network data to identify a root cause of the lost connection; and send, to a neighbor network device selected from the one or more neighbor network devices and based on the identified root cause, instructions for the first network device to perform an action to remediate the lost connection, wherein the neighbor network device communicates the instructions to the first network device.Type: ApplicationFiled: March 4, 2022Publication date: September 7, 2023Inventors: David Jea, Xiaoying Wu, Jisheng Wang, Yuan-Hsiang Lee

Patent number: 11658354Abstract: Described herein are embodiments of methods and apparatus for determining the SoC and SoH a lithium ion battery and for restoring capacity to a lithium ion battery. Some embodiments provide a method and apparatus including an ultrasound transducer designed to measure characteristics of a lithium ion battery in order to determine the SoC and SoH of the lithium ion battery, and to disrupt the SSEI layer inside the lithium ion battery. Several other methods for determination of SoC and SoH and disruption of the SSEI layer are also described. Use of such methods and apparatus may be advantageous in assessing a state of the lithium ion battery, as well as rejuvenating a lithium ion battery and increasing its life span.Type: GrantFiled: May 30, 2018Date of Patent: May 23, 2023Assignee: TITAN ADVANCED ENERGY SOLUTIONS, INC.Inventors: Shawn Murphy, Ashish Sreedhar, Vincent Yuan-Hsiang Lee, Steven Africk

Patent number: 10436716Abstract: A substance analysis system and method are provided, the system disposable a variable stand-off distance from a substance in situ, including an emitter disposed to emit radiation onto the substance in situ, and a detector disposed the variable stand-off distance from the substance in situ, the detector comprising a receiver defining a substantially collimated collection path over the variable stand-off distance.Type: GrantFiled: September 24, 2014Date of Patent: October 8, 2019Assignee: Smiths Detection, Inc.Inventor: Vincent Yuan-Hsiang Lee

Patent number: 10165477Abstract: One embodiment of the present invention provides a system for configuring an access point in a wireless network. During operation, the access point discovers one or more existing access points associated with the wireless network. The access point then obtains a set of configuration information from one existing access point, and synchronizes a local timestamp counter to a selected existing access point, thereby allowing the access point to be configured without using a centralized management station.Type: GrantFiled: July 7, 2017Date of Patent: December 25, 2018Assignee: Ubiquiti Networks, Inc.Inventors: Sriram Dayanandan, Bo-chieh Yang, Yuan-Hsiang Lee, Keh-Ming Luoh, Robert J. Pera

Patent number: 9354178Abstract: Systems and methods for analyzing samples in containers are provided, where an emitter emits radiation at a first location on the container, with a portion of the radiation passing through the container and into the sample, some of the radiation is reflected within the container, a detector receives a transmission Raman signal including Raman radiation from multiple portions of the sample, and a comparator compares the transmission Raman signal with the radiation emitted by the emitter.Type: GrantFiled: March 5, 2014Date of Patent: May 31, 2016Assignee: Smiths Detection Inc.Inventor: Vincent Yuan-Hsiang Lee
